Product Introduction

Overview

The CPH3355-TL-W is a P-Channel Power MOSFET produced by onsemi. This component is designed for high-performance applications requiring low on-resistance and high current handling. Although the CPH3355-TL-W is currently obsolete and no longer manufactured, it remains a significant component in many existing designs.

The MOSFET is packaged in a SOT23-3 case, which is a compact surface mount package suitable for a wide range of electronic circuits. It features a trench technology design that minimizes gate charge and on-resistance, making it suitable for applications with low gate charge driving or low on-resistance requirements.

Key Features

  • Trench Technology: The CPH3355-TL-W is produced using onsemi's trench technology, which minimizes gate charge and on-resistance, making it suitable for applications requiring low gate charge driving or low on-resistance.
  • Low On-Resistance: With a drain-source on-resistance of 213 mOhms, this MOSFET offers efficient switching and minimal power loss.
  • High Current Handling: Capable of handling a continuous drain current of 2.5 A and a peak current of 10 A for short pulses.
  • Compact Package: Packaged in a SOT23-3 case, which is a compact surface mount package ideal for space-constrained designs.
  • ESD Protection: The gate is ESD diode-protected, enhancing the component's reliability in harsh environments.
  • RoHS Compliance: The component is Pb-Free, Halogen Free, and RoHS compliant, making it suitable for use in environmentally friendly designs.
